
FUROR GALLICO have released a video for “Call Of The Wind”, second single taken from the new album “Future To Come” to be released on March 22nd by Scarlet Records.
video by Raoul Noise/Nova Rolfilm Studios
Produced by guitarist Gabriel Consiglio;
Mixed by Federico Ascari (Within Destruction, Signs Of The Swarm);
Mastered by Jens Bogren at Fascination Street Studios (Opeth, Arch Enemy, Amon Amarth);
Featuring Ralph Salati (Destrage) on guitar on “Faith Upon Lies”;
FFO: Eluveitie, Ensiferum, Blind Guardian, Amorphis, Wind Rose;

After the successful “DuskOf The Ages” campaign, with the “Canto D’Inverno” video reaching 4,6 million views on YouTube, Furor Gallico are back with a vengeance, once again brilliantly blending extreme metal music with traditional Celtic, Irish and Breton tunes in their fourth record.
While “Future To Come” cannot be considered as a concept-album, most of the songs are based on the idea of physical and spiritual redemption.
The listener will be thrown in a multifaceted world where every song is one of many scenarios – from epic and apocalyptic landscapes to the inner reconciliation with ourselves and the Earth – each unique in its style and yet well balanced, so to take him on a journey through life’s sorrows and deliverance.
